If you are over 60 and ready to refresh your look with something bold, low-maintenance, easy to style, and age-defying, a choppy pixie cut is the way to go. The beauty of pixie cut is that there is always something for you, whether you are embracing your natural gray, dealing with thinning hair, or just want something that screams confidence.
Best Low Maintenance Choppy Pixie Cuts for Over 60
This article contains 30 low-maintenance choppy pixie cuts for over 60 that flatter every face shape, work with any hair type, and fit effortlessly into your lifestyle.
1. Stacked Pixie with Side Bangs
Perfect for oval or round faces, this stacked pixie adds lift at the crown and sweeps side bangs to give you a younger look. This is a good choice if you want a thick haircut that is easy to style.

2. Choppy Pixie with Messy Layers
This haircut is a good pick for the woman who wants to wake up and go without investing too much time to look beautiful. You are good to go with a finger tousle and a touch of texture spray.

3. Pixie with V-Cut Nape and Choppy Bangs
The sharp V-cut creates a sleek neckline while the bangs frame the eyes, which makes it suitable for square or heart-shaped faces looking to add flair to their facial beauty.

4. Textured Pixie with Bangs
Add bounce and lift with layers that do all the work. It goes well for both formal and casual events. Maintaining it is easy; you just need a quick scrunch to define it.

5. Gray Pixie Bob
This is a perfect choice if you’ve embraced your natural gray. It is classy, timeless, and stylish. Ask your stylist for feathered ends to soften the edges.

6. Glam Layered Pixie
This layered pixie cut never goes out of style. Sweep the bangs with a round brush and finish with shine spray. You can keep the bangs choppy or side-swept, and the haircut will still look good.

7. Edgy Undercut Pixie
Look two decades younger and fabulous with this rockstar haircut. This undercut is modern and edgy but still mature. Regularly trim the layers to keep them short and neat.

8. Side-Parted Pixie with Layers
A deep side part flatters long or narrow faces. Add extra bounce to your haircut by blow-drying with a small round brush and misting with lightweight spray.

9. Tousled Layered Pixie
This one is made for movement. Great on fine or medium hair and low maintenance, you just need to run some texturizing cream through damp strands and keep it looking fresh at all times.

10. Disheveled Pixie
The messier, the better. It’s playful, easy, and looks amazing on oval or full faces. It gives you a younger and edgy look. Pop in a headband, and you’re ready to head out.

11. Volumizing Pixie for Fine Thin Hair
You don’t have to worry if your hair is thin. Just get a volumizing cut, as it uses smart layering to create the illusion of fullness.

12. Simple Side-Parted Pixie
It is best for women who prefer clean lines and subtle style without much effort. Keep it well structured by adding a little serum for polish and shine without weighing hair down.

13. Choppy Layered Pixie with Side Bangs
Bold layers and side bangs help to frame your facial features beautifully to give you a younger appearance. Use a small flat iron or a fingertip press to keep the cut cute.

14. Minimal Pixie with Wispy Bangs
This cut is all about soft edges and graceful style. Keep it light with a feather comb-through and soft setting spray. You can part it at the center and add side bangs, and it will still look awesome.

15. Simple Pixie with Choppy layers
This is your reliable go-to for everyday glam. Choppy layers add volume, and a dab of cream keeps it from looking too neat and relaxed but refined.

16. Layered Pixie with Longer Side Bangs
Longer fringe adds elegance and makes this cut perfect for hiding forehead lines. Great for glasses wearers. You only have to tuck one side behind the ear for charm.
17. Pixie with Precise Short Layers
This precise layering brings structure and style without effort. For rounder faces, this cut can add definition and angle. Just style the haircut with a flat brush and go.
18. Shaggy Pixie
Textured and layered in the best way. It is ideal for anyone with a free spirit and a love for volume. Use dry shampoo to keep the lift going all week.
19. Dimensional Pixie with Low Lights
Subtle lowlights add dimension to your haircut, making it great for gracefully graying. Ask for cool-tone highlights around the face to brighten and bring youthfulness to your look.
20. Capped Pixie with Side Bangs
This close-fitting cap cut hugs the head and flatters petite faces. Add side bangs to make it more versatile and cuter. You can keep it sleek or tousled, depending on your mood.
21. Razor Pixie Cut
Look youthful and dynamic with this razor-cut pixie that delivers drama and edge without being over the top. Pair with silver hoops or cat-eye glasses for a youthful spin.
22. Asymmetrical Pixie
If you’re bold and want to make a statement with your haircut, this one’s for you. One side longer gives a modern, artsy vibe, which makes the haircut unique.
23. Mixed-Tone Angled Curly Pixie
You can style your curls dynamically today by keeping them angled and mixing the color hues. Use a curl cream and diffuser for a soft, touchable texture.
24. Gray Curly Pixie with Side Bangs
Embrace your natural gray curls in a youthful way. The side bangs soften your forehead and highlight cheekbones, making an ideal haircut for softness and easy maintenance.
25. Long Layered Pixie with Low Lights
This longer pixie keeps some length while adding volume up top. Lowlights add richness, which makes it perfect if you’re transitioning from color to gray.
26. Feathered Layered Pixie
Feathered layers bring softness that complements your facial features and adds uniqueness to your choppy pixie. Blow dry with a round brush to maintain the airy volume and texture of the layers.
27. Layered Pixie with Feathered Side Bangs
Feathered bangs offer subtle movement that feels elegant without trying too hard. A light serum and gentle blow dry keep it bouncy. Regularly trim the bangs to keep them from overgrowing.
28. Pixie with Nape for Thick Hair
If you have thick hair, a pixie with a tapered nape helps to reduce weight and keeps things tidy. Great for staying cool and stylish through warmer seasons.
29. Pixie with Mohawk
Keep your pixie cut fun and highly textured with this faux-hawk style. Ideal for women with fine, thin hair, this is an ideal everyday haircut style during the cooler months.
30. Undercut Pixie
Chic and edgy, the undercut works wonders for thinning hair by emphasizing the top volume. Just apply a little dry wax to bring it all together.
